SNMP
SNMP, the Simple Network Management Protocol, is a protocol for Internet network management. It was first described in RFC 1089. One place to start learning about SNMP is SNMP Research at < http://www.snmp.com/>. To use these functions under UNIX, you must have the UCD SNMP libraries. You can find them at <http://ucd-snmp.ucdavis.edu/>. Documentation at this site is more specific to the library PHP uses. I've attempted to follow their examples by translating them into equivalent PHP code.
